Kubota P0134 – Engine Control Module (ECM): EGO1 Open/Lazy (HO2S1) / Oxygen Sensor Circuit No Activity Detected (Bank 1, Sensor 1)

Issue description

Triggered when the engine's primary computer detects that the upstream Heated Exhaust Gas Oxygen (HEGO) sensor (located before the catalytic converter) is inactive. The system sets this code if the sensor remains persistently cold for more than 120 seconds, if the heater feed circuit is open, if the signal wire is open or shorted to ground, or if the sensor is completely inoperative.

Check the cause

  1. Inspect the O2 sensor wiring harness and connector for visible damage, corrosion, or loose connections. Ensure the sensor wire is not mispositioned and melting against the hot exhaust.

  2. Test the harness for a short to ground or an open circuit on the O2 signal wire and the 5V return ground.

  3. Verify that the O2 sensor heater circuit is receiving voltage. If the heater circuit is open, the sensor will remain cold and fail to switch.

  4. Inspect for exhaust leaks upstream of or immediately near the O2 sensor, as introducing outside air can cause false readings or sensor inactivity.

  5. Using an OBD-II scanner or the Kubota Gasoline Service Tool (KGST), monitor the Bank 1 Sensor 1 voltage. A healthy sensor should fluctuate rapidly. If the voltage is stuck (often below 0.1V) or shows no activity, the sensor is dead.

  6. Ensure the ECM grounds are clean, tight, and in their proper locations.

Repair steps

  1. Preparation

    Turn off the engine, disconnect the negative battery terminal, and allow the exhaust system to cool completely to avoid burns.

  2. Locate the Sensor

    Locate the upstream oxygen sensor (Bank 1, Sensor 1). It will be threaded into the exhaust manifold or exhaust pipe before the catalytic converter.

  3. Disconnect

    Unplug the electrical connector for the O2 sensor. Be careful with the plastic locking tabs.

  4. Removal

    Using a 22mm wrench or a dedicated slotted O2 sensor socket, carefully unscrew the faulty oxygen sensor from the exhaust pipe.

  5. Installation

    Thread the new OEM oxygen sensor into the exhaust manifold by hand to prevent cross-threading, then tighten it to the manufacturer's specified torque.

  6. Reconnect

    Plug the electrical connector back into the engine wiring harness. Ensure the wire is routed safely away from extreme heat sources.

  7. Clear Codes

    Reconnect the battery, turn the ignition on, and use your diagnostic scanner to clear the P0134 / DTC 134 fault code.

  8. Test Drive

    Start the engine and let it reach operating temperature. Verify via your scanner that the engine successfully enters "Closed Loop" fuel control mode and that the new sensor's voltage is fluctuating properly.
